Characteristics and tasting tips for the Auxey-Duresses Village "Les Closeaux" 2023 from Domaine Pierre Vincent

Tasting

Color
The color shows a bright ruby shade, adorned with pinkish reflections.

Nose
The bouquet is both earthy and floral, expressing aromas of fine cherries, accompanied by delicate floral notes. One also perceives notes of cassis and red currant, highlighted by earthy and spicy nuances.

Palate
On the palate, the wine appears compact and still somewhat closed in its tight structure, with dense grain and pure juice. The texture is savory, possesses nice volume and offers an authentic expression of the terroir.

Food and wine pairings

This wine pairs perfectly with fine dishes, especially furred game such as roe deer.

Service and storage

It is recommended to wait at least 2 years before tasting the Auxey-Duresses Village "Les Closeaux" 2023, so that its full aromatic complexity can unfold. If you wish to enjoy it sooner, decanting is highly recommended. This wine can be cellared until around 2033.

An authentic wine from Auxey-Duresses from old vines in the Côte de Beaune

The estate

Founded in 2009 under the name Terres de Velle, Domaine Pierre Vincent now extends over 7 hectares in Auxey-Duresses, in the heart of the Côte de Beaune. Taken over in July 2023 by Pierre Vincent, a renowned oenologist and former General Manager of Domaine Leflaive, along with Hervé Kratiroff and Eric Versini, the estate continues an artisanal approach that highlights the authenticity of the Burgundian terroir. Managed organically since the beginning and now in conversion to biodynamics, the vineyard produces 16 micro-cuvées annually from prestigious appellations, including Corton-Charlemagne Grand Cru.

The vineyard

The Les Closeaux cuvée comes from a single 0.6815-hectare plot in Auxey-Duresses, planted between 1962 and 1970. These old Pinot Noir vines thrive on clay soil with a southeast exposure. The name "Les Closeaux" refers to a large plot located above the Ruisseau des Cloux, with the plural suggesting that it formerly consisted of several small Clos or Closeaux, former gardens or small walled vineyards. The soils are first tilled and then grassed over, with very little use of inputs. Harvesting is done manually with systematic sorting, and the harvest date is carefully determined through strict monitoring of maturity.

Winemaking and aging

The Auxey-Duresses Village "Les Closeaux" 2023 is vinified with 50% whole bunches. After a pre-fermentation cold maceration, the vatting period lasts 15 days. Aging takes place for 18 months in oak barrels, including about 20% new barrels, before the wine is racked into stainless steel tanks prior to bottling.

Grape variety

This Burgundy wine is 100% Pinot Noir.
